A Private Jet

You might think that a lot of celebrities and professional athletes own their own private jets, but odds are they rent them for long weekends. The actual price of buying a private jet can be upwards of $65 million and that’s not including jet fuel and hiring a pilot. Those who rent a private jet either for convenience or for the false picture of wealth spend about $2,000 per hour. A Boat

Here’s one of those situations where you have to go big or go home. When we say boat, we’re talking multi-million dollar yachts. This thing could be just as big if not bigger than you’re new house and more expensive than your private jet. If you search the world’s most expensive luxury yachts, the Streets of Monaco comes in number one at $1.1 billion. Give Back

Since you should give back even when you don’t have too much money to count, there’s no excuse when you have too much money to count. There are countless charities to choose from in which you can donate money. You could start a scholarship in your name, give money to a local organization, or even help an individual or specific family out directly. When you have a ton of money, you don’t miss a few thousand dollars here and there, and knowing it went to a good cause is even better.
